Kisii Governor James Ongwae has dismissed claims that he is selfish and stingy.

According to the county boss, he has been giving financial support to Kisii residents more especially bodaboda riders whenever he moves around Kisii County.

"I'm not stingy, Kisii residents should know that I give to people generously. It is important to note that we will all leave money and wealth on this earth once we die. I feel happy when I give out any financial support to residents of Kisii and bodaboda riders can attest to that," said Ongwae in Kisii town on Sunday. 

He assured residents that he will continue helping the less fortunate in the society arguing that the hand that gives receives blessings in return.

Ongwae challenged Kisii residents especially those from well-established families to consider giving a helping hand to those from poor families. 

The second term governor urged parents across the county to invest in their children through education.

"For the future generation to live a good life there is a need for parents to ensure their children are educated since it is through education that we can only shape the lives of the future generation," Ongwae added.
